Bernard Durkan (Kildare North, Fine Gael) | Oireachtas source
Some of the manufacturers are concerned about having to create a multiplicity of labels, with storerooms full of batches of labels for this and other markets.
I am uncertain about another matter. The warning will not take up one third of the space on bottles. That would have been over the top. If we were to go to that extreme, we would be better off just telling people that the products being sold were poison and should not be consumed at all. We need to impose a health warning so that every person consuming the product knows that it has certain side effects. Food irradiation has similar effects, but we have no warnings on our fruit, vegetables and so on yet.
How will this system work in practice and will it achieve the intended outcome? Will the warning label also make reference to the calorie content?
